fix: correctly select active player (YouTube & Spotify)#580
fix: correctly select active player (YouTube & Spotify)#580Maxcrazy1 wants to merge 5 commits intogh0stzk:masterfrom
Conversation
|
Probé tu código localmente, y tuve varios problemas, las notificaciones entre cambio y cambio de canción en spotify dejaron de funcionar, si no me equivoco spotify internamente tiene la funcion de mostrar notificaciones. También en los reproductores qué no son spotify, las notificaciones se muestran doble y al cerrarlas siempre se abre una nueva y después vuelve a mostrarse doble. |
|
Ok, me parece que me falto un bloque de código que tengo en otro archivo relacionado con el cambio de notificaciones, hablando un poco sobre eso hace como 2 semanas o poco más esas notificaciones internas de Spotify ya no funcionaron más, yo antes las tenia pero me toco codear para que reaparecieran correctamente. Si es cierto lo de las notificaciones dobles, ayer lo note con otras plataformas tengo que ajustarlo, y probaré con el MPD sinceramente no uso el servicio por eso no hice las pruebas necesarias en ese lado, proximamente ajustaré mas este script y seguramente toquetee un segundo archivo donde tengo un demonio a la escucha eso se me paso anexarlo al PR. |
|
Ya tengo casi listos los cambios, no he subido por tiempo, y que he estado haciendo pruebas, ya funciona adecuadamente con Spotify, MPD y Youtube Music, mañana termino de probar y si veo todo ok lanzo update al PR. |
|
Aun no revises estimado, que subi los cambios para probarlos ahora en una maquina virtual asi validar en un entorno limpio que funciona normal. |
…ayer notifications
|
@gh0stzk listo estimado, ya hice las pruebas con MPD, Youtube Music, Spotify y el funcionamiento se ve bastante adecuado, lo único que no pude probar fue que tomara los cambios al instalar desde 0 la libreria, no tuve tanto tiempo ajustar esa parte, aproveche unos días de descanso y bueno allí quedo, tengo otro update que hice a los screenshots y me ha venido de lujo creo que podría beneficiar a otros puede que lo suba luego en un PR diferente. |
|
Hola, gracias por tu PR, ahora esta semana que viene podre probarlo. Gracias. |
|
Hola @gh0stzk he encontrado algunos aspectos menores para mejorar este script, estaré hoy en la tarde ajustando algunos detalles para que después lo revises y me comentes si ves algo. |
…ent notifications in notify_song script
Problema
Los controles de reproducción se comportan de manera inconsistente cuando Spotify y YouTube están abiertos al mismo tiempo. Se me desaparecieron las notificaciones de notify-send.
Solución
Detectar el reproductor activo que está reproduciendo
Recordar el último reproductor controlado
Usar MPD como respaldo si no hay ningún reproductor activo
Reactive las notificaciones para que se visualicen las caratulas y el reproductor, no se que se rompió.